It can be mixed into batters for cakes and cookies before baking. For custards, creams, and sauces, adding it near the end of cooking or after removing the pan from the heat can preserve more aroma.
Prolonged high heat can reduce some volatile aroma compounds. Avoiding unnecessary boiling and overcooking helps the vanilla note stay more noticeable.
Using too much can make the flavor compounds taste sharp, perfumed, or slightly bitter. Start with a small amount and adjust gradually rather than adding a large dose at once.
It can work in many recipes, but the result will not be identical. Vanilla extract generally has a more layered flavor, whereas flavoring often gives a simpler, more direct vanilla taste.
Keep it tightly closed in a cool, dry cupboard away from direct sunlight. Heat and light can gradually dull the flavor, and refrigeration is usually unnecessary.
Freezing is generally not needed and may affect the product's texture or uniformity. For longer keeping, store it sealed in a cool, dark place instead.
Yes. Its aroma can enhance the perception of sweetness, helping some recipes taste satisfying with less added sugar. It cannot, however, fully replace sugar's role in texture, browning, or structure.
It works well in coffee, yogurt, oatmeal, smoothies, and baked goods. Cinnamon, cocoa, banana, berries, and stone fruit are especially compatible, but use a light hand so it does not overpower other flavors.
